Unsaturated polyester resin composite with sugar cane bagasse: influence of treatment on the fibers properties

The aim of this work is to evaluate the influence of the sugar cane bagasse NaOH treatment in the mechanical and dynamic-mechanical properties, in the thermal stability, density and water absorption, when used in unsaturated polyester resin/sugar cane bagasse composite. The sugar cane bagasse was submitted to the chemical treatment with alkaline solution of NaOH. The treatment improves the impact and flexural elasticity modulus when compared with resin without fibers, in addition to the adhesion of the fibers with the matrices, but does not improve significantly the tensile elasticity modulus. The surfaces of the impact fracture were analyzed by SEM.
